  • Back at our Inside The Ropes Live show in Manchester back in July 2016, Paul Heyman opened up about how he became CM Punk's Advocate from receiving a call from Vince McMahon, to describing the scenes backstage with the big reveal in the car, The Special Counsel to the the Tribal Chief explained how both he and Punk thought it was funny that WWE decided to pair them up, because it was a recipe for disaster.
